Power BI MCP Server Explained in Tamil | Connect AI with Power BI Dataset

 


MCP Server with Power BI – AI-க்கு Complete Model Context எப்படி கொடுக்குது? (Tamil)

Power BI-யை AI tools-கூட connect பண்ணும்போது ஒரு common problem என்னன்னா,
AI smart-ஆ இருந்தாலும் Power BI model-ஐ முழுசா understand பண்ண முடியாம generic answers மட்டும் தர்றது.
இந்த blog-ல நம்ம MCP Server (Model Context Protocol) Power BI-க்கு என்ன problem solve பண்ணுது,
AI + Power BI integration எப்படிச் accurate-ஆ work ஆகுது,
real demo-ல என்ன benefit கிடைக்குது
அப்படின்னு step-by-step-ஆ பார்க்கலாம்.


Power BI + AI – Earlier Problem என்ன?

Power BI-க்கு Copilot, ChatGPT மாதிரி AI tools வந்தாலும், ஆரம்பத்துல ஒரு பெரிய limitation இருந்துச்சு.

AI-க்கு தெரியாத விஷயங்கள்:

  • Table names & purpose
  • Relationships எப்படி work ஆகுது
  • Measures-ல logic என்ன
  • Business meaning என்ன

இதனால:

  • Generic answers
  • Wrong / inefficient DAX
  • Irrelevant visuals suggestions
  • Manual correction every time

👉 Root cause: Missing context

MCP Server என்ன? (Model Context Protocol)

MCP Server basically Power BI model-க்கும் AI-க்கும் இடையில translator மாதிரி work ஆகும்.

Simple-ஆ சொன்னா:

  • Power BI model-oda full context AI-க்கு pass பண்ணும்
  • Guess work தேவையே இல்லை
  • AI directly model-ஐ read பண்ணும்

MCP provide பண்ணும் context:

  • Tables
  • Columns
  • Relationships
  • Measures
  • Calculations
  • Semantic model metadata

👉 MCP = Context provider, not just data provider

MCP Power BI-க்கு எப்படி help பண்ணுது?

MCP implement பண்ணும்போது:

  • AI-க்கு table name, fact vs dimension automatically தெரியும்
  • Date columns, measures purpose correct-ஆ identify ஆகும்
  • DAX logic accurate-ஆ generate ஆகும்
  • Correct visuals recommend பண்ணும்
  • Business-friendly answers கிடைக்கும்

Result:
❌ Incorrect results avoid
✅ Accurate DAX
✅ Relevant visuals
✅ No manual rework

MCP Architecture – Simple Explanation

Think of MCP as:

Power BI ↔ MCP Server ↔ AI (Copilot / ChatGPT)

  • Power BI model → MCP
  • MCP → full context → AI
  • AI → correct answer → back to you

Bidirectional transformation நடக்கும்.

Power BI Dataset MCP-க்கு Connect பண்ணும் Demo

இந்த demo-ல:

  • VS Code + GitHub Copilot use பண்ணி MCP access பண்ணுறோம்
  • Power BI dataset successful-ஆ connect ஆகுது
  • “Connected successfully” confirmation கிடைக்கும்

Example Question:

“எத்தனை dimension tables, எத்தனை fact tables இருக்கு?”

AI response:

  • Fact table: Sales
  • Dimension tables: Customer, Calendar, Sales Executive, Segments, Teams
  • Measures table identified correctly

👉 Just text input — model read & response perfect.

Advanced Query Demo – Business Question

Next level question:

  • Top 3 customers by lifetime purchase
  • Their most purchased product
  • Quantity count

AI:

  • Correct customer
  • Correct product
  • Correct quantity
  • Business-ready output

👉 No guessing, no manual joins.

Write Operations using MCP (Game Changer 🔥)

MCP only read-only இல்ல.

Example:

  • “Repeat Customer” measure-க்கு description இல்ல

Prompt:

Model-ஐ understand பண்ணி calculation validate பண்ணி proper description update பண்ணு

Result:

  • AI generates correct business description
  • Description automatically updated in Power BI model
  • Saved permanently

👉 This is model write capability

Why MCP is Important for Power BI Users?

If you are:

  • Power BI Developer
  • Data Analyst
  • BI Architect

MCP helps you:

  • Save time
  • Avoid wrong DAX
  • Improve AI trust
  • Work faster with Copilot

⚠️ Note:
  • MCP is still preview feature
  • Production data-ல try பண்ண வேண்டாம்
  • Always test with sample / test datasets



கருத்துரையிடுக

0 கருத்துகள்